Awards & Grants
Awards
2025
Recipient of the National Art Education Association’s History and Historiography of Art Education Caucus Award for Distinguished Historian of Art Education
2023
Recipient of The National Art Education Association’s Mac Arthur Goodwin Award for Distinguished Service Within the Profession
2017
Recipient of The National Art Education Association Eastern Region Art Educator of the Year Award (Higher Education Division)
2006
Recipient of the Arthur Wesley Dow Scholarship, Art & Art Education Program, Teachers College, Columbia University, New York, NY

Grants
2020
Mapping International Histories of Art Education
Provost’s Investment Fund Grant, Office of the Provost, Teachers College, Columbia University. Lead organizer of an international conference exploring international histories of art education.

2015
Brushes with History: Imagination and Innovation in Art Education History
Special Projects Funding, Office of the Provost, Teachers College, Columbia University. Co-developed and organized a national conference reimagining historical inquiry in art education.

2014
Recipient of the National Art Education Foundation Research Grant (2014-15) for conducting historical/archival research on Mabel D’Amico (1909-1999): Tales left untold

2006
Recipient of the Spencer Foundation Research Training Grant at Teachers College, Columbia University for 2006-2007 for dissertation research on Re-Framing the past: Re-making invisible histories of nineteenth century pedagogies of drawing in colonial India
